A Much Deeper Problem Than Hypocrisy: Romans 2:17-24
“17) But if you bear the name “Jew” and rely upon the Law and boast in God, 18) and know His will and approve the things that are essential, being instructed out of the Law, 19) and are confident that you yourself are a guide to the blind, a light to those who are in darkness, 20) a corrector of the foolish, a teacher of the immature, having in the Law the embodiment of knowledge and of the truth, 21) you, therefore, who teach another, do you not teach yourself? You who preach that one shall not steal, do you steal? 22) You who say that one should not commit adultery, do you commit adultery? You who abhor idols, do you rob temples? 23) You who boast in the Law, through your breaking the Law, do you dishonor God? 24) For “ THE NAME OF GOD IS BLASPHEMED AMONG THE GENTILES BECAUSE OF YOU,” just as it is written.” Romans‬ ‭2:17-24‬ ‭
Are you ready to wrestle with a profound theological concept? God intended for the Jewish people to be the salt of the earth and the light to the world. But the salt had long since gone bad and the light had gone out. The Law was still the Law, but it lost its status as a moral code for salvation because not even the Jewish people followed it or kept it.
But wait, maybe there was another issue at work under the surface. Maybe the Law was never intended to be a means of salvation. Maybe it was given to expose the sinfulness of mankind and the need for a Savior.
Let’s ask the question another way; If God’s own chosen people could not keep the Law, who could? The answer is, “only Jesus Christ.” Paul is going to drive these points home over the next few chapters.
He concludes that the Gospel is needed because all people are sinful and lost. (See Romans 3:19-20) It is totally futile to embrace a good works based system of religion in an attempt to save yourself. Keeping the Ten Commandments cannot save you, because you have already broken many of them.
What Paul is doing in the opening three chapters of Romans is proving beyond all doubt that “all have sinned and come short of the glory of God.” (Romans 2:23). He systematically looks at every people group and concludes they are lost. He even pulls the lid off Judaism and shows that God’s own chosen people are lost.
He points out that Religion cannot save people because it fails to make them holy. It can make them do better and feel better, but it fails to deliver the personal holiness needed to enter the into presence of God.
According to 1 Peter 1:16, God doesn’t want us to be better, He wants us to be Holy. Only the Gospel of Jesus Christ and the inner work of the Holy Spirit can produce that conversion. Anything short of that will cause the world to mock at us just like they mocked Judaism. (See Romans 2:24)
